The chart above should read

Car Side - Use               -    Pin

Red           IG 12V               Pin 1   Yellow

Black         RPM signal       Pin 2    White

Brown       Ground              Pin 4    Blue

Blue          Perm Live          Pin 5

Green       illumination        Pin 6
